Presenting LIK's April issue Yogurt Fair Biggest Event in Town of Razgrad, Mayor Dobrev Says

The Yogurt Fair and the Festival of Folk Traditions and Handicrafts are the largest events in the city, said Razgrad Mayor Dobrin Dobrev at the BTA National Press Club in Razgrad during the presentation of the April issue of BTA's LIK magazine, dedicated to Bulgaria's participation in world expos. Dobrev noted that the festival now boasts one of the largest craft exhibitions in the country, bringing together artisans from across Bulgaria at more than 100 booths, with growing public interest each year.

Bulgaria Protests War Memorial Vandalism in Serbia

A protest note was delivered by Bulgaria’s Ambassador to Serbia Petko Doykov at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Serbia in response to acts of vandalism against Bulgarian military monuments in Belgrade and Nis, the Bulgarian Embassy in Belgrade wrote on its Facebook page on Friday.

Head of Serbian Cultural Monuments Protection Institute Arrested After Alleged Falsification of Documents Pertaining to Sought-after Buildings in Belgrade

The acting director of the Republican Institute for the Protection of Cultural Monuments in Serbia, Goran Vasic, has been arrested. Vasic had proposed to the Serbian government that the status of cultural monument of the two buildings of the General Staff of the former Yugoslav Army, partially destroyed during NATO bombings in 1999, be removed, Serbian media report.

"Europe on Balkans: Cohesion Skills" in Targovishte Project on Adult Learning Agenda Is Example of Local Implementation of European Policies, Says Chief Secretary of Targovishte Regional Administration

The project on implementing the renewed priorities of the European Adult Learning Agenda is a good example of how European policies can be successfully implemented at the local level, with real benefits for residents, Todorka Taneva, Chief Secretary of the Targovishte Regional Administration, said during a local conference held here on Wednesday. The event was part of BTA’s Europe on Balkans: Cohesion Skills project.
